NVIDIA GeForce RTX 3060 12 GB GA104 vs ATI Radeon HD 4850
NVIDIA GeForce RTX 3060 12 GB GA104 vs ATI Radeon HD 4850
VS
NVIDIA GeForce RTX 3060 12 GB GA104
ATI Radeon HD 4850
We compared two Desktop platform GPUs: 12GB VRAM GeForce RTX 3060 12 GB GA104 and 512MB VRAM Radeon HD 4850 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A GeForce RTX 3060 12 GB GA104 's Advantages
Released 13 years and 3 months late
Boost Clock1777MHz
Larger VRAM bandwidth (360.0GB/s vs 63.55GB/s)
2784 additional rendering cores
ATI Radeon HD 4850 's Advantages
Lower TDP (110W vs 170W)
